Public Notice Sample & Direction
Crafting a proper legal statement can seem daunting, but understanding the crucial elements and having a useful example to guide you is vital. A typical legal notice often includes the name of the party issuing it, a concise overview of the matter at issue, the time the announcement is being released, and access information. For instance, if dealing a property dispute, a statement might detail the concerned property, the nature of the dispute, and a timeline for resolution. Remember that jurisdiction and specific legal protocols differ, so consistently consult with a attorney professional to confirm your announcement is rightfully enforceable and adhering with regional regulations. We can't provide thorough legal advice; this information is for informational purposes only.
Here's a brief list of what to include:
- Issuing Party Details
- Subject Matter Description
- Date and Time of Publication
- Contact Information for Inquiries
